Let's set the scene now. I launched this new Sprint container my one month marketing Sprint via Slack. And And I had zero desire to build a long funnel or do a big launch. I wanted to keep it simple. I wanted it to feel intimate. And I wanted the right people, not just the most people. So I did what I always do. I showed up online with intention. I created content that spoke directly to the people that I wanted to help. I let them see me. I also shared behind the scenes of what I was working on. And I talked about client wins. And when people responded, I did not send them a Google Doc link right away. I pulled out my phone, opened my DMs and said, hey girl, I saw your comment and I think the Sprint will be perfect for you for where you're at. Let me tell you what to focus on. No pressure, no pitch deck. Just clarity, connection, and real conversation. Here's what actually sold it. Spoiler alert. It wasn't the tech. Let me tell you the difference between sales that flow and sales that feel forced. It's not your software. It's your storytelling. It's not your email sequence. It's your energy. People buy when they feel seen, understand the value, believe that you actually care about their success. So here's what I want you to walk away with today. These are the four things that helped me sell out of the Sprint. Just using content, voice notes. The first thing is a crystal clear offer. I knew exactly what I was selling, what was included, and what the problem was that it solved. Your offer should pass. The grandma Test. Can someone with zero context understand what this is? The second thing, consistent visibility with purpose. Every story, every post, every live was driving awareness, not pressure. And when people engage, I didn't just like their comment, I actually started a conversation. The third thing is permission based selling. I didn't cold pitch. I invited. Would you like me to tell you more? Game changer. It keeps things human and respectful. And guess what? It works. The fourth thing is I use my voice to build trust. Fast. Voice notes are underrated, friend. In 60 seconds I can express warmth, excitement and clarity way better than a block of text. And nine times out of ten that voice note is what made them say yes. Now you can do this too. You do not need a 20 email sequence to book your next five clients. You need a juicy clear offer, a simple visibility plan that highlights the value, real conversations that feel like you and the courage to follow up and stay persistent.
